Title
Theoretical and experimental analysis of spatiotemporal field coupling of ultrashort pulses diffracted by circular amplitude apertures

Abstract
In this context, we proposed a scheme based on spatially resolved spectral interferometry. In our proposal, a fiber optic coupler is used instead of a standard interferometer which makes the system very simple and robust in comparison with other approaches.
